PURPOSE OF STUDY

It is apparent from the scriptures that it is not just those who hear the Word of God shall be blessed but those who hear and do them. It is also very clear that the Lord is interested in seeing the work of salvation help us live in the spirit and not in the flesh. We also understand that the Lord’s purpose is to be perfect and holy as He is.

Yes, we can work miracles and do so many other things but if we are not like sheep, a child as we live our life of relationship with and under the leadership of the Holy Spirit – all amount to works of unrighteousness and iniquities.

The question and quest to live in the Spirit and by the Spirit which are manifested in being like Jesus adjudged by the fruit of the Spirit then becomestoo important to be neglected nor taken for granted. The above therefore are the reason and reasons for our new series of study in the fruit of the Spirit.

INTRODUCTION

No fruit comes to be or grow except the farmer has a vision, makes a decision, with great determination, and is intentional with work. The process of farming suggests that there is a plan, a land, a clearing, making of ridges, a planting or sow, a watching, weeding, watering, mercy and benevolence of God for good weather and land to yield increase, and great expectation.

The purpose of farming is to have harvests which are made up of fruits in order to live physically, financially and otherwise, take care of a number of other things. In the same token when a man becomes born again he gains the power to be fruitful in holiness and begin to live a perfect life unto God in the process of time.

He also losses intentionally, by decision and the power of the Holy Spirit, the power to sin, continue to live in iniquity and unrighteousness. A born-again child of God has created a state of warfare directly and indirectly. This shall be his/her pattern of living. It is outside his/her control. Ephesians 4:22 | 2 Timothy 2:22 | James 4:1 | 1 Peter 4:2. The joy however is that he or she is in warfare from a position of victory in Christ Jesus – Romans 8:37.



WHAT IS THE FRUIT OF THE SPIRIT ?

We shall consider Ten Ways To Understand – living in the fruit of the Spirit Consider these Bible Passages – John 1:12-13 | Galatians 5:22-25 | John 1:14 | John 1:12-13.

THE TEN WAYS/DEFINITIONS TO KNOW AND UNDERSTAND THE FRUIT OF THE SPIRIT

1. It is living the life of Christ. Galatians 2:20
2. It is living in the power of the Holy Spirit. Acts 1:8
3. It is being led, guided and directed by the Holy Spirit. It is the Holy Spirit working upon your life as a farmer and you are the land bringing forth fruit and harvests. Romans 8:14 | Luke 3:9 | Luke 8:5.
4. It is submission and complete obedience to God. James 4:7.
5. It is living holy and not in sin. 1 Peter 1:15
6. It is the opposite of living in the flesh. Galatians 5:16
7. It is living according to the Word of God. Colossians 3:16
8. It is living as a resemblance and representative of Jesus. Matthew 10:25a
9. It is completely pleasing the Lord. Colossians 1:10.
10. It is living as a citizen of heaven here on earth. Hebrews 11:16
